Alcala de Henares University building facade, Madrid Province, Spain. 17th century Patio Mayor of the Antigua Universidad or Colegio de San Ildefonso. The swan motif on the well is the emblem of Cardinal Cisneros the powerful cleric and statesman who founded the university (cisne meaning swan, in Spanish). The University and Historic Precinct of Alcala de Henares is a UNESCO World Heritage Site.
